Qualcomm, the leading chipmaker, has initiated job cuts as part of its regular business operations. The company faces challenges in the smartphone market and aims to streamline its workforce.

Qualcomm, the renowned chipmaker, has recently confirmed that it is implementing job cuts as part of its normal course of business operations. The company, which specializes in mobile processors and communication chips, has been facing challenges in the smartphone market, prompting this strategic move
1
.The decision comes amid a broader slowdown in the smartphone industry, which has been a key driver of Qualcomm's growth in recent years. The company has been grappling with reduced demand for smartphones, particularly in China, which has impacted its revenue and necessitated cost-cutting measures
2
.While Qualcomm has not disclosed the exact number of employees affected by this round of job cuts, reports suggest that the layoffs could impact hundreds of workers across various departments. The company has stated that these reductions are part of its ongoing efforts to streamline operations and align its workforce with current business needs
1
.In response to inquiries about the job cuts, a Qualcomm spokesperson emphasized that the company regularly evaluates its operations to ensure they are appropriately structured. The spokesperson stated, "As part of a normal course of business, we are realigning our workforce to deliver on our technology roadmap and support our long-term growth opportunities"

Qualcomm's decision to reduce its workforce is not an isolated incident in the tech industry. Many major technology companies have been implementing similar measures in response to economic uncertainties and changing market dynamics. Competitors in the semiconductor industry, such as Intel and NVIDIA, have also announced job cuts in recent months, reflecting the broader challenges facing the sector
2
.Despite the current challenges, Qualcomm remains committed to innovation and growth in key areas. The company continues to invest in 5G technology, artificial intelligence, and the Internet of Things (IoT), which are expected to drive future growth. These strategic focus areas are likely to shape Qualcomm's hiring and resource allocation decisions in the coming years
